Public Good

A public good is a good that is both non-excludable and non-rivalrous, meaning individuals cannot be effectively excluded from use and use by one does not reduce availability to others.

Nonrival

A characteristic of a good where its consumption by one individual does not reduce its availability to others; often associated with public goods.
